Embodiment 1

[0024] Embodiment 1: A control method of a mobile air conditioner.

[0025] Such as figure 1 Shown, a kind of control method of portable air conditioner comprises the following steps:

[0026] Real-time monitoring of the distribution of people in the room after the air conditioner starts running;

[0027] Acquiring the temperature distribution of the indoor personnel distribution space;

[0028] Determining the ideal position and working mode of the air conditioner to be moved according to the temperature distribution of the indoor personnel distribution space;

[0029] The air conditioner moves to the desired position. Abstract

The invention provides a movable air conditioner control method, a computer readable storage medium and an air conditioner. After the air conditioner is started and runs, indoor personnel distributionis monitored in real time; temperature distribution of the indoor personnel distribution space is obtained; according to temperature distribution of the indoor personnel distribution space, the idealposition where the air conditioner needs to move and the work mode are determined; and the air conditioner moves to the ideal position. Through real-time monitoring of indoor personnel distribution,temperature distribution of the indoor personnel distribution space is obtained to determine the ideal position where the air conditioner needs to move and the work mode, then the air conditioner automatically moves to the ideal position according to the automatically-determined ideal position for corresponding air adjustment, accordingly, the intelligent degree of the movable air conditioner is improved, and the movable air conditioner can rapidly meet the user comfort requirement; and meanwhile, operation is more intelligent, more energy is saved, and the user experience can be better improved.
